The Zener Diode Unit provides a practical platform for demonstrating how a Zener diode behaves in an electrical circuit. In forward bias, a Zener diode operates similarly to a conventional semiconductor diode. In reverse bias, it is designed to conduct after the applied voltage reaches its specified Zener breakdown voltage.

The unit can be connected to a suitable regulated DC power supply, current-limiting resistance and measuring instruments. How to Use the Zener Diode Unit

Identify the anode and cathode terminals marked on the unit.

Confirm the Zener voltage, current limit and power rating of the installed diode.

Keep the regulated DC power supply switched off while connecting the circuit.

Connect a suitable current-limiting resistor in series with the Zener diode.

Connect the diode in forward or reverse bias according to the selected experiment.

Connect an ammeter in series and a voltmeter across the diode where required.

Increase the supply voltage gradually and record the corresponding readings.

Switch off the supply before reversing polarity or changing connections.

Safety note: Never operate the diode without suitable current limiting. Excessive reverse current or operation beyond the rated power can permanently damage the Zener diode.

What is Zener breakdown voltage?

Zener breakdown voltage is the reverse voltage at which a Zener diode begins to conduct significantly while maintaining an approximately stable voltage across it within its rated operating range.

Why is a resistor connected in series with the Zener diode?

The series resistor limits current through the diode. Without adequate current limiting, the diode can overheat and fail.
